#construct_id_map_for_composite(records) ⇒ Object
Given a collection of ActiveRecord objects, constructs a Hash which maps the objects’ IDs to the relevant objects. Returns a 2-tuple (id_to_record_map, ids)
where id_to_record_map
is the Hash, and ids
is an Array of record IDs.
226 227 228 229 230 231 232 233 234 235 236 237 |
# File 'lib/composite_primary_keys/association_preload.rb', line 226 def construct_id_map_for_composite(records) id_to_record_map = {} ids = [] records.each do |record| primary_key ||= record.class.primary_key ids << record.id mapped_records = (id_to_record_map[record.id.to_s] ||= []) mapped_records << record end ids.uniq! return id_to_record_map, ids end |

#set_association_collection_records(id_to_record_map, reflection_name, associated_records, key) ⇒ Object
162 163 164 165 166 167 168 169 |
# File 'lib/composite_primary_keys/association_preload.rb', line 162 def set_association_collection_records(id_to_record_map, reflection_name, associated_records, key) associated_records.each do |associated_record| associated_record_key = associated_record[key] associated_record_key = associated_record_key.is_a?(Array) ? associated_record_key.join(CompositePrimaryKeys::ID_SEP) : associated_record_key.to_s mapped_records = id_to_record_map[associated_record_key] add_preloaded_records_to_collection(mapped_records, reflection_name, associated_record) end end |
#set_association_single_records(id_to_record_map, reflection_name, associated_records, key) ⇒ Object
171 172 173 174 175 176 177 178 179 180 181 182 183 184 185 186 187 |
# File 'lib/composite_primary_keys/association_preload.rb', line 171 def set_association_single_records(id_to_record_map, reflection_name, associated_records, key) seen_keys = {} associated_records.each do |associated_record| associated_record_key = associated_record[key] associated_record_key = associated_record_key.is_a?(Array) ? associated_record_key.join(CompositePrimaryKeys::ID_SEP) : associated_record_key.to_s #this is a has_one or belongs_to: there should only be one record. #Unfortunately we can't (in portable way) ask the database for 'all records where foo_id in (x,y,z), but please # only one row per distinct foo_id' so this where we enforce that next if seen_keys[associated_record_key] seen_keys[associated_record_key] = true mapped_records = id_to_record_map[associated_record_key][:records] mapped_records.each do |mapped_record| mapped_record.send("set_#{reflection_name}_target", associated_record) end end end |
